Iterate on data usage chart UI.

Switched to inflating chart views from XML, using attributes for
configuration.  Start using drawable assets for chart components
instead of manually painting.  Include hand-cut assets, and animate
between states when touched to invoke.

Clamp sweeps to valid chart ranges and prepare for sweep labels.
